The Facilitation of Child Development in a Japanese Nursery School

This paper aims to explore the topic of facilitating children’s development in a Japanese day-care centre (hoikuen). The research is based on a case study with participant observation in the daycare facility Minami Ōsawa Nursery School in Tōkyō. After a short overview on preschool education in Japan and an introduction to Minami Ōsawa Nursery School, the three main topics of child development around the age of five years-cognitive, social-emotional and motor development- will be further explored. These three areas will be defined more precisely in the context of the selfproclaimed aims and daily routine of the hoikuen team. Furthermore the importance of a child’s autonomy is addressed.
